On-camp and Off-camp Work Permits

As an international student applying to study and work in Canada with a Canadian work permit is having double opportunities to work. However, the applicant can work on-campus and off-campus.

However, what we mean by working on-campus is that: As an international student who gains admission into a particular institution. With the help of the work permit, he still has the opportunity as an employee. He can still work in that same Institution to erns money to help himself or herself.

The Source of the Employment Must be from that same Institution

(Your employer must be from the Institution that the student is admitted to). While Working off-campus means working for any Canadian employer outside of the school.

It must be clearly stated in your study permit that you are allowed to study and work in the county of Canada. Also, the condition of the work, the hours, the total duration, etc.

Social Insurance Number (SIN)

Another essential document that guarantees you, as an international student, to study and work simultaneously in Canada is your Social Insurance Number (SIN), which you will get from Service Canada. This Insurance Number will help you when applying for a job as a student in Canada.

Studying and working in Canada is mainly for those international students. And the duration of their program is from one to four years. Therefore, if your program is for less than a year. We are advising you that the authority will not allow you to study and work in the country of Canada. That is to say that If your study program is less than six months in duration. You cannot study and work in Canada unless otherwise authorized. Or if you are learning French as a Second Language (FSL) or English as a Second Language (ESL) program.
